> > JavaFX runtime is not free. Check out the revised Sun binary license, > > http://www.java.com/en/download/license.jsp > > It says, > > "Unless enforcement is prohibited by applicable law, you may not > modify, decompile, or reverse engineer Software...." > > It goes on to exclude the JavaFX runtime specificially from the open > source material, > > " Sun grants you a non-exclusive, non-transferable, limited license > without fees to reproduce and distribute the Software (except for the > JavaFX Runtime)," > > It is clear that Sun wants to extract the benefit of projecting > something as open source free software and at the same time wants to > hold on to the runtime as proprietary software. They are just waiting > to see how it turns out. :-) > > As we have already seen in the FSFS conference Sun is able to market > JavaFX (think about the publicity they got) as a free software even > though it is proprietary.
